Griglia FRP: La soluzione ottimale per i sistemi di drenaggio delle raffinerie petrolifere

In the intricate and harsh environment of oil refineries, drainage systems play a vital role in maintaining operational efficiency and environmental compliance. These systems are constantly exposed to a cocktail of corrosive chemicals, high temperatures, and viscous substances such as oil and grease. Selecting the right material for components within these drainage systems is crucial, and Fiberglass Reinforced Plastic (FRP) grating has emerged as an ideal choice, offering a suite of benefits that address the unique challenges of oil refinery operations.​Oil refineries handle a wide array of aggressive substances during the refining process. Acids, alkalis, and various petrochemical solvents are commonly present in the wastewater that flows through the drainage systems. Traditional materials like metal gratings are highly susceptible to corrosion in such environments, leading to structural weakening and potential failure over time. FRP grating, constructed from a polymer matrix reinforced with fiberglass, provides exceptional resistance to these corrosive agents. Its non – metallic composition ensures that it does not rust or corrode, even when continuously exposed to the harsh chemicals in refinery wastewater. Griglie in FRP: Una scelta superiore per le piattaforme delle centrali elettriche

In the complex and demanding environment of power plants, where safety, durability, and functionality are of utmost importance, the selection of appropriate materials for platforms is a critical decision. Fiberglass Reinforced Plastic (FRP) grating has emerged as an excellent option, offering a multitude of benefits that make it highly suitable for power plant applications.​ Power plants often operate in environments where moisture, chemicals, and aggressive substances are prevalent. Whether it’s the presence of cooling water treatment chemicals in thermal power plants or the corrosive by – products in waste – to – energy facilities, traditional materials like steel can quickly succumb to rust and degradation. FRP grating, composed of a polymer matrix reinforced with fiberglass, provides outstanding resistance to corrosion. This ensures that the platforms maintain their structural integrity over long periods, reducing the need for frequent and costly replacements due to material deterioration. Safety is a top priority in power plants, especially considering the high – voltage electrical systems that are an integral part of their operations. FRP grating is non – conductive, acting as an effective electrical insulator. Griglie in FRP: La soluzione ideale per le passerelle degli impianti chimici

In the demanding environment of chemical plants, where safety, durability, and corrosion resistance are paramount, choosing the right material for walkways is crucial. Fiberglass Reinforced Plastic (FRP) grating has emerged as the ideal solution, offering a combination of properties that make it highly suitable for this challenging application.​Exceptional Corrosion Resistance​One of the most significant advantages of FRP grating is its outstanding corrosion resistance. Chemical plants are filled with a variety of aggressive chemicals, including acids, alkalis, and solvents, which can quickly degrade traditional materials such as steel and concrete. FRP grating, on the other hand, is made from a polymer matrix reinforced with fiberglass, providing excellent resistance to these corrosive substances. This ensures that the grating maintains its structural integrity and functionality over an extended period, even in the harshest chemical environments.​High Strength – to – Weight Ratio​FRP grating offers a high strength – to – weight ratio, making it lightweight yet incredibly strong. This characteristic simplifies the installation process, reducing the need for heavy – duty lifting equipment and minimizing labor costs. L'aumento del grigliato FRP autopulente e il suo impatto sulla manutenzione delle superfici

In modern engineering, materials that boost performance while cutting maintenance are highly sought after. Fiberglass Reinforced Plastic (FRP) grating, known for its strength and corrosion resistance, has evolved with self-cleaning coatings. This combination offers enhanced convenience and efficiency in surface upkeep, making it popular across industries.​FRP grating, a composite of glass fibers in a polymer matrix, excels in mechanical properties. It’s strong, rust-proof, and suitable for industrial, marine, and architectural uses. However, it can accumulate dirt and grime, affecting both appearance and functionality.​Self-cleaning coatings on FRP grating work via physical and chemical means. Hydrophobic coatings create superhydrophobic surfaces, allowing water to bead and roll off, carrying away debris. Photocatalytic coatings, containing materials like titanium dioxide, use UV light to break down organic contaminants, with hydrophilic effects aiding in their removal.​The benefits of FRP grating with self-cleaning coating are substantial. In industry, it reduces cleaning time and costs, boosting productivity. In the marine sector, it prevents salt and algae buildup, extending structure lifespan. In architecture, it keeps surfaces clean, eliminating risky and expensive high-rise cleaning. Environmentally, it cuts chemical use and water consumption.​This technology is seeing rapid adoption, especially in food processing and wastewater treatment.
